Output 70251e8fc61b5dfe566e504e57fbbfc7356991bcfc030847c88f8eab0b217258:98

value
28295000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 177f99c7518f9f6eb446daa3d0af6a818c6a0f39 OP_EQUALVERIFY OP_CHECKSIG
address
139FQGK6GQ4pG1o8dykSkAccJx5t8U9Ub1
transaction
70251e8fc61b5dfe566e504e57fbbfc7356991bcfc030847c88f8eab0b217258
spent
true